The Mental Health Crisis: Why Immediate and Affordable Care Needs to Become the Norm

The US is facing a mental health crisis with millions unable to access timely, affordable treatment. The system is failing patients with a lack of prompt care, high costs, strict admission guidelines for inpatient treatment and a reliance on emergency rooms. The solution could lie in emergency psychiatry, offering same-day access to treatment, and the use of telehealth services. However, in order to be successful, the cost barrier must be removed, expanding insurance and treatment provider networks and creating new payment structures.
